French Bulldog Puppies For Sale

French bulldogs are a wonderful option for those living in urban areas or those who have limited access to large outdoor areas. They are small in size and require a moderate amount of exercise, which can typically be accomplished through their regular indoor routines and short walks on a daily basis.

They also require minimal maintenance in terms of grooming, since they require only regular brushing to remove wrinkles from their genes. They are also easy to train.

Frenchies are adapted to urban living and thrive in smaller spaces. They are also very athletic and are able to compete in dog sports. They can also be lazy and would love to lay around with you on the couch. Despite their tendency towards laziness, Frenchies need daily exercise and can be fulfilled by short walks or playtime.

Frenchies are susceptible to a variety of health issues, such as hip dysplasia, ear infections and hip dysplasia. However with a healthy diet and regular veterinary care, they can remain healthy. They must be fed a premium food that is specifically designed for small breeds and should always have access to water. It is also essential to clean their hereditary creases regularly to prevent irritation or infection.

Like any puppy it's important to begin training early. Frenchies respond well to positive reinforcement and are eager learners. They also excel at learning tricks and catching food, making them great candidates for obedience training. Training properly will help them develop into a well-behaved and social adult dog.

Frenchies are able to get along with other pets, like cats and dogs. However, they might not like rough play and could be easily annoyed if not given the chance to unwind and relax. They also are prone to anxiety over separation, which could lead to behavioral problems if left alone for prolonged periods of time.

They make a wonderful family pet

French Bulldogs are affectionate and loving dogs that make great companions for families. They are easily trained and be able to adapt to different situations. They are also very tolerant of pets and children. Despite their grim faces, they are jolly dogs that enjoy entertaining their family and their friends. They enjoy playing but also love relaxing on the couch or a dog bed.

Before purchasing a French Bulldog it is important to understand the requirements of the breed. They require regular grooming and ear cleaning. They also need to be kept warm, especially when it's cold outside. Beware of hot or humid areas since they could be afflicted with heat strokes.

If you're looking for a Frenchie, it's best to get one from an established breeder. This will ensure that the puppy is healthy and socialized with other animals. The puppy should also have the most recent vaccinations as well as a guarantee of health. You should also make sure that your home is dog-proofed to avoid accidents from happening.

It's important to socialize a new puppy as soon as possible. This breed thrives on human attention. This will allow your puppy to grow into a confident and well-mannered adult. It's important to bring your Frenchie for regular check-ups at the vet and to get shots. By keeping up with these appointments, you can avoid serious health problems later.

Frenchies require daily exercise in order to remain healthy and active. It is crucial to keep their wrinkles in good shape as they are prone to snore and drool as well as snore. Additionally, because they are brachycephalic, they cannot cool themselves as easily as other dogs and can become overheated quickly.

They are a wonderful therapy animal

French Bulldogs are easy to train and are great companion dogs. They are smart, and they love to please their owners. They also enjoy playing and have a fun personality. However, they can be inflexible and require patience in their training. Rewarding them with treats and positive reinforcement could help inspire them to learn. This breed is low-maintenance and does not require as much exercise. They can also be a great fit in smaller living spaces, like apartments, provided they are properly supervised. They do however tend to snore, drool and may not enjoy warm weather.

Frenchies are excellent with children and work well in a household. Children love giving them their complete attention, and they are renowned for being loyal companions. It is essential to interact with your puppy early and often with other dogs, children, and people. This will help make your pup more comfortable with strangers and keep him from becoming anxious when left alone for prolonged periods of time.

You should teach him basic obedience commands the same way you would any other puppy. Begin with "sit," the easiest command to master, French Bulldog and will serve as the foundation for all other commands. After that, you can move on to more advanced tricks and exercises for obedience. Be calm and positive with your puppy during training sessions.

Frenchies can play with their owners but they cannot handle prolonged rough play or exertion. This can cause breathing problems and heat stress. Always be watching your French Bulldog when they are playing.

It is also important to teach your puppy the basic household manners, such as not getting into people's faces or chewing furniture. It is also crucial to puppy-proof your house so that your French Bulldog doesn't have access to cleaning products and chemicals that could cause harm to him.
